About Us
Since 2003, Just Goods has been providing the Michiana area high-quality products that are safe for you to wear and use in your home.
We research the companies that produce our goods to assure they pay their workers a fair wage while using environmentally-friendly materials and methods of production.
You can feel good about your purchases, knowing that they are helping to build a more just world and to preserve our earth for generations to come.
As consumers, we have the power to change our world by voting with our dollars. When we patronize locally-owned businesss, and purchase organic, and fairly-made items we:
- own something beautiful we can feel good about
- send a clear message to companies that ethics matter and their policies affect their bottom line
- invest in manufacturers we respect
- help preserve jobs in the U.S.
- support environmentally-responsible production methods
- build strong communities
